Unlike older wireless cards that were fully self-contained, the 9461 relies on the laptop's Intel processor (Chipset) to handle some of the processing load. This means the card is deeply integrated into the system's motherboard. Because of this deep integration, the driver is complex; it doesn't just talk to the card, but coordinates with the CPU's communication subsystem.

On paper, it’s not flashy: 1x1 802.11ac, 433 Mbps max, Bluetooth 5.1, integrated into select Intel chipsets. But its driver? That’s where stability lives or dies.

The Intel Wireless-AC 9461 is a robust piece of hardware hampered by the complexity of its software integration. Because it relies on the CPU (CNVi technology) and shares antennas with Bluetooth, the driver has a difficult job balancing power efficiency, interference, and bandwidth.
